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48871796 849 2780
12 970
12 970
405935 9582309719 53940089
All about undefined
Interested in learning more?
12 970
405935 9582309719 53940089
See more
2652323553 3504059031 8302116907
9935 94870 15
See more
6694044 0824
3542287 927631989 88171372
See more